Output e1521043d4fb113dd61586cc4ad3e5db266469969aca1d8bb26a5ce965456420:34

value
2450000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c80ed22c32654ba49c03525f57d29eb6cb4ca65 OP_EQUALVERIFY OP_CHECKSIG
address
1CMKEkAKpToAHCahNYnqgLniApbgFKMtbv
transaction
e1521043d4fb113dd61586cc4ad3e5db266469969aca1d8bb26a5ce965456420
spent
true